Data Architect

Inter IKEA, Delft, Netherlands | June 2025 - Present

At Inter IKEA, I started by creating a plan to optimize the data interface and exchange landscape. Through years of growth, thousands of point-to-point interfaces had emerged without holistic oversight or governance. This resulted in insufficient control over data quality, lineage, and applicability. Where initially thought was given to “a new data platform,” the real need proved to be structurally organizing and scaling data governance and data management.

I wrote a pragmatic and executable plan that:

  • Clearly assigns ownership and responsibilities for data domains and lifecycle management
  • Positions a small, focused enablement team to guide business and data teams in capturing metadata, data standards, and data quality rules
  • Defines processes and minimal tooling for catalog, lineage, contracts, and change management, so interfaces grow from point-to-point to manageable patterns
  • Enables step-by-step cleanup and consolidation of connections without disrupting operations

This approach shifted focus from “more technology” to “better governance”, resulting in faster insight into data flows, improved data quality, and a sustainable foundation for decision-making and further modernization.

Data Architect

Viterra, Rotterdam, Netherlands | October 2021 - December 2024

At Viterra, I had a key role in shaping and executing the data strategy within a complex, international environment. My work spanned both hands-on data architecture and structurally improving data governance, platform design, security, and innovation.

In the first phase, I focused on bringing structure and scalability to a largely unstructured research environment. The Research department worked mostly with external datasets in free formats. I designed and built a new data platform specifically tailored to this situation — with support for analytics, machine learning, and reporting on global commodity markets. This platform formed the basis for predictive models and reliable insights, giving the team a stable and well-managed foundation to build upon.

Simultaneously, I worked on setting up Viterra’s broader data strategy. I defined the desired architecture, aligned it with business goals and information flows, and ensured that governance, information security, and access control based on responsibilities were structurally embedded within a federated model.

In the second phase, I led the implementation of the data strategy. I designed and documented Viterra’s complete data landscape and established key data management processes within the organization. As lead Data Architect, I was responsible for the rollout of the new Snowflake platform, standardizing data modeling, and improving information management. I also introduced a central data catalog and brought in business architecture principles to better connect data to operational practice.

During this period, I also led the implementation of an AI solution with Snowflake Cortex, based on LLM technology. This use case showed how AI could contribute to improving internal search functions and knowledge discovery.

In addition to the technical work, I coordinated the internal BI team and worked closely with departments to modernize data flows, improve data quality, and stimulate adoption of new tooling. In doing so, I applied principles of behavioral design and decentralized responsibility to promote adoption in a federated organizational context. My approach was strategic and pragmatic — focused on delivering value and building trust within the organization.
